Etymology: Lentipes: Latin, lens, lentis = slow + Latin, pes = foot (Ref. 45335);  adelphizonus: From the Greek adelphos, meaning brother, and more generally twin, in pairs, and zona, the latinized form of the Greek zone, meaning belt or girdle, in reference to the two broad bars on the body..

Asia: Island of Halmahera, Maluku in Indonesia.

Short description Morfologia | Morfometria

Spine dorsali (totale): 7; Raggi dorsali molli (totale): 9-10; Spine anali 1; Raggi anali molli: 9 - 10. Males possesses two broad dusky to blackish bars, one ventral to first dorsal fin, one between second dorsal and anal fins. Pectoral with 16-18 rays. In first dorsal fin, membrane touching anterior base of second dorsal fin, black spot between spine and first ray in second dorsal fin, spot sometimes elongate forming a short bar. Preopercular pores present along preopercular margin. Papilose finger-like projections anterior to urogenital papilla (Ref. 57053).

Biologia     Glossario (es. epibenthic)

Inhabits fast flowing, clear streams with rocky and boulder-strewn bottom (Ref. 57053).
